How they compare

Jordan currently reports 191,646 t against 131,760 t in Lithuania, a difference of 59,886 t.

That makes Jordan's figure about 1.5 times Lithuania's.

The two have swapped places 1 time across 15 shared years of data; in 2003 it was Lithuania ahead.

Jordan ranks 8th and Lithuania ranks 10th of 88 countries.

Lithuania has averaged higher in every one of the 3 decades both report.

The Fertilizers by Product dataset contains information on the Production, Trade and Agriculture Use of inorganic (chemical or mineral) fertilizers products. The fertilizer statistics data are for a set of 23 product categories. Both straight and compound fertilizers are included.
